Bathroom Mold Removal Tips: Understanding Mold Growth

Knowing why mold appears is the first of your Bathroom Mold Removal Tips. Mold spores are everywhere—floating in the air and settling on damp surfaces. In the bathroom, frequent hot showers spike humidity above 70%, creating the ideal breeding ground. Without air circulation, water vapor sits in grout on tile, behind vanities, and in corners to favor mold colonies to grow. Finding the cause factors is the key first step in creating successful mold removal procedures.

Factors Critical to Mold Development:

  • Higher Humidity: Shower water vapor accumulates on cold surfaces like mirrors and windows.
  • Poor Ventilation: Low or poorly maintained exhaust fans trap humid air.
  • Residue of Organic Matter: Soap scum residue, shampoo films, and body oils feed mold spores.
  • Stealthy Leaks: Running faucets or wet substrate material behind the walls or under floors.

Identifying Common Symptoms: Mold Removal Guidelines

In order to use mold removal guidelines effectively, you first need to identify mold’s characteristic signs:

Observable Signs of Mold

  • Dark spots or stains on caulking, grout lines, and tile joints.
  • Pigmentation around the edge of shower trays, behind taps, and under sinks.
  • Black, green, or white patches with fuzzy or slimy texture.

Odor Signs for Mold

  • A persistent, musty odor even after thorough cleaning.
  • The smell intensifies in the corners or behind closed doors.

Regular inspections—at least fortnightly—help in early identification of mold so that you can use the optimal bathroom mold removal techniques before the condition worsens.

Preparation and Safety: Urgent Mold Removal Techniques

Preparation is essential prior to undertaking deep cleaning:

  1. Seal Off the Area: Keep doors closed and place a damp towel at the threshold to prevent spores from spreading.
  2. Personal Protective Equipment: Wear an N95 mask or respirator, chemical-resistant gloves, goggles without ventilation holes, and long-sleeve clothing.
  3. Ventilation Setup: Open any window and turn on the exhaust fan. If no window exists, position a small airflow fan near the doorway to direct air outside.

Step-by-Step Mold Removal Process

Employing strategic, expert bathroom mold removal guidance entails a well-considered, step-by-step process:

1. Eliminate Sources of Moisture

  • Check and repair faucet, showerhead, and plumbing fixture leaks.
  • Dry standing water with a wet/dry vacuum or mop.

2. Prepare Your Cleaning Solution

  • Bleach Solution: Mix 1 cup of household bleach with 1 gallon of water.
  • Vinegar Spray: Undiluted white vinegar in a spray bottle works on hard surfaces.
  • Alternative: A 50/50 ammonia and water mixture—but never combine ammonia and bleach.

3. Apply and Dwell Time

  • Generously spray or sponge the solution onto mold-affected areas.
  • Let sit for 10–15 minutes; tough colonies may require up to 20 minutes.

4. Scrub and Cleanse

  • Use a stiff nylon brush on tile and grout; a soft cloth on drywall and painted surfaces.
  • For embedded mold in caulk, replace the caulk after cleaning; mold can penetrate sealants.

5. Rinse and Thoroughly Dry

  • Rinse with warm water to remove chemical residue and dead spores.
  • Wipe surfaces with a dry towel or use a cool hairdryer for hidden niches.

6. Repeat if Necessary

  • Inspect after drying; repeat treatment if discoloration or odor persists.
  • Avoid repainting or re-caulking until the area is completely mold-free and dried.

Post-Removal Cleanup: Disposal and Sanitization

After mold removal, proper cleanup prevents reinfestation:

  • Dispose of Contaminated Materials: Seal rags, masks, and disposable gloves in a plastic bag and throw them away.
  • Sanitize Reusable Tools: Soak brushes and goggles in a bleach solution for at least an hour.
  • Air Out the Space: Leave the exhaust fan running for several hours to clear lingering spores.

Ventilation Upgrades: Long-Term Mold Prevention

Proper airflow is your strongest ally in mold prevention. Integrate these Bathroom Mold Removal Tips into your maintenance routine:

Exhaust Fans and Airflow

  • Upgrade to a high-capacity, humidity-sensing exhaust fan that activates automatically when moisture peaks.
  • Clean fan filters and ducts quarterly to maintain peak performance.

Natural Ventilation Enhancements

  • Install louvered vents in doors or walls to promote cross-ventilation if structural changes are possible.
  • Leave windows slightly ajar after use, even in cooler months.

Routine Maintenance: Keeping Mold at Bay

Incorporate the following Mold Elimination Guidelines into biweekly or monthly chores:

  • Inspect & Spot-Treat: Check grout lines with a flashlight and spot-treat any discoloration immediately.
  • Wipe Down Wet Surfaces: After every shower, squeegee tiles and glass; hang towels to dry instead of leaving them on the floor.
  • Deep Clean Monthly: Use a vinegar-based spray or mild detergent on all bathroom surfaces, including hidden corners and behind the toilet.
  • Check Caulking & Grout: Re-seal any cracked or worn areas with mold-resistant caulk.

Advanced Tips: Technology and Innovations

Stay ahead of mold with emerging gadgets and materials:

  • UV-C Sanitizing Lights: Install in vents to disrupt mold spores at a molecular level when the bathroom is unoccupied.
  • Antimicrobial Grout: Replace standard grout with new formulations infused with silver or copper ions to inhibit microbial growth.
  • Smart Humidity Sensors: Integrate sensors that send alerts to your smartphone when humidity exceeds safe levels.
